About Our Opportunity


The Capital Markets Administration and Compliance (CMAC) division is responsible for the accounting, debt servicing, trade settlement, reporting, and custody of government’s market debt and investments while monitoring compliance with legislation and policies. The division provides professional advice, recommendations, and coordination of policies and guidelines related to debt management activities. In addition, the division reconciles government bank accounts, monitors and reports on government’s financial internal controls, manages governance specific software solutions, and corporate compliance programs.

Primary Accountabilities


Reporting to the Bank Reconciliation Supervisor, the Bank Reconciliation Clerk is responsible for providing accurate and timely accounting, reporting and support for all financial transactions of the province processed through the major charted banks. The incumbent will also be responsible for analysis of financial and technical data required to ensure proper allocation and financial conformity. Additional responsibilities include monitoring clearing accounts, creating and testing posting rules, processing stop payments and responding to inquiries. From time to time the Bank Reconciliation Clerk assists in training, business enhancements and procedure development.

Qualifications and Experience


The successful candidate must possess a Grade 11 education plus five years relevant experience or equivalent combination of training and experience may be acceptable. Preference will be given to those with post-secondary accounting training.

As the ideal candidate you have experience with banking services, financial accounting, financial reporting and reconciliations. Experience reconciling bank accounts as well as preparing journal entries is essential. Excellent written and verbal communication skills, interpersonal skills and the ability to work both independently and in a team are required.

Candidates need to possess a high attention to detail and a working knowledge of GAAP and SAP. Sound judgement and problem-solving skills are required to allow for the accurate interpretation of information to make effective decisions daily. An above average understanding of the banking industry and web-based banking platforms would be an asset. 

Computer proficiency using a variety of tools, including Excel, Word, and Outlook is essential.
